Simplfied Chinese
哀莫大于心死
Traditional Chinese
哀莫大於心死
Mandarin pinyin pronunciation
āi mò dà yú xīn sǐ
Cantonese jyutpin pronunciation
oi1 mok6 daai6 yu1 sam1 sei2
Short definition nothing sadder than a withered heart
Usage frequency Very infrequent
Chinese synonyms Chinese Gratis iconChinese tools icon (Click icons, results will appear below)
 
All available English definitions (saying attributed to Confucius by Zhuangzi 莊子|庄子)MDBG icon / The worst sorrow is not as bad as an uncaring heart.MDBG icon / Nothing is more wretched than apathy.MDBG icon / other possible translations: no greater sorrow than a heart that never rejoicesMDBG icon / nothing sadder than a withered heartMDBG icon /
